Last Saturday, Husky House volunteers gathered at Amy Hofer's North Haledon home awaiting a shipment of rescued dogs the group pulled from a kill shelter in Georgia as part of Project Hope. The shipment was the result of an email Hofer received earlier in the week with a list dogs scheduled to be gassed. "Between us and another women that I have a contact with down there, we ended up saving all of them," Hofer said. Despite screening all of the dogs for health issues, one group of puppies arrived testing positive for Parvo. An extremely deadly disease for puppies, one of the four puppies died Sunday morning the rest are being treated for the disease.
The Husky House, based in North Jersey, can be found online at www.huskyhouse.org.
